This Global Certificate Course in Ethical Leadership for Tourism Boards equips participants with the knowledge and skills to navigate the complex ethical challenges facing the tourism sector. The program emphasizes sustainable tourism practices and responsible management.
Learning outcomes include a deep understanding of ethical decision-making frameworks applicable to tourism, the development of strategies for promoting ethical behavior within tourism organizations, and the ability to implement effective corporate social responsibility initiatives. Participants will also gain proficiency in stakeholder engagement and conflict resolution.
The course duration is typically flexible, often designed to accommodate professionals' busy schedules, with modules delivered online and potentially including a few intensive workshops. Specific details regarding the duration should be confirmed directly with the course provider.
The course boasts significant industry relevance, addressing the growing demand for ethical and sustainable practices within the tourism sector. Graduates will be better equipped to lead their organizations toward greater social and environmental responsibility, enhancing their reputation and attracting ethical consumers and investors. The curriculum integrates case studies and real-world examples related to sustainable tourism development, governance, and community engagement.
This Global Certificate Course in Ethical Leadership for Tourism Boards is designed for tourism professionals seeking to enhance their leadership skills and contribute to a more responsible and sustainable tourism industry. Successful completion provides a valuable credential showcasing commitment to ethical leadership and sustainable tourism management.
